Gallery visits

ESCALA

ESCALA

The Essex Collection of Art from Latin America (ESCALA) is a unique research and teaching resource giving our students the chance to engage with over 750 artworks from 1900 to the present.

London art world

Essex is just an hour by train from the centre of the London art world. Our students enjoy regular visits to major galleries including Tate Modern, Tate Britain, the National Gallery and Royal Academy of Arts, as well as to the many independent and alternative spaces.

Most undergraduate modules include compulsory gallery visits every year as part of our teaching, with travel to London subsidised by our School.

Essex Collection of Art from Latin America

Based at the University, our Essex Collection of Art from Latin America (ESCALA) gives you the opportunity to encounter art works first hand both in a class situation and through our Collection’s ongoing programme of exhibitions at Colchester’s Firstsite gallery. The Collection was founded by our School of Philosophy and Art history, and is the largest of its kind in Europe.

Art Exchange

Art Exchange is our University gallery and runs an ongoing programme of exhibitions of contemporary art, artist and curator talks, as well as hosting exhibitions organised by students from our Centre for Curatorial Studies.

Firstsite

Firstsite is a large and iconic exhibition venue designed by internationally recognised architect Rafael Viñoly and based in the centre of Colchester. The gallery runs an ongoing programme of contemporary art exhibitions, as well as film screenings, talks and music events. Firstsite is also home to an exhibition space of our Essex Collection of Art from Latin America (ESCALA).
